Here is your scenario: During a tough match, three of your players form a passing triangle in the midfield to bypass the defense.
* Player A passes to Player B (15 meters away).
* Player B passes to Player C (22 meters away).
* The angle formed at Player B between the two passes is 115°.
**The Challenge:** Calculate the exact distance Player C needs to pass the ball to get it straight back to Player A! 🏃‍♂️💨
Hint: Dust off those non-right-angled triangle formulas! Which rule do you need here? 🤔
